Abstract
A display device according to an exemplary embodiment of the present invention includes: a substrate; a plurality of first assembly lines extending along a column direction on the substrate; a plurality of second assembly lines extending along the column direction on the substrate and disposed adjacent to the plurality of first assembly lines; a plurality of first assembly electrodes connected to the plurality of first assembly lines; a plurality of second assembly electrodes connected to the plurality of second assembly lines and facing the plurality of first assembly electrodes; a plurality of transistors electrically connected to each of the plurality of first assembly lines and the plurality of second assembly lines; and a plurality of assembly pads connected to the plurality of transistors, the plurality of transistors being configured to transmit voltage from the plurality of assembly pads to the plurality of first assembly lines and the plurality of second assembly lines. Therefore, voltage can be selectively applied to each of the plurality of assembly lines by using transistors, and the self-assembly regions of light-emitting diodes can be configured in various positions and sizes.
